psg
15.03.2019, 12:17 |
Atrybuty specjalne (Forum) |
Witam,
w ośrodku potrzebują żeby w atrybutach danego obiektu, gdzie nie znamy wartości, w miejscu gdzie mogą być stosowane atrybuty specjalne to żeby je wstawiać.
Mowa tu o atrybutach z załącznika nr 2 z rozporządzenia o mapie zasadniczej z 2015r. np.: "inapplicable", "missing" itp.
Nie wiem też jak sam powinienem to wpisywać, żeby właściwie im się pokazywało, czy "missing" czy może"<missing>" ?
Jeśli będzie możliwość to może udało by się Panu to wstawić w odpowiednie miejsca. Chyba, że już jest to możliwe a nie zauważyłem.
Pozdrawiam. |
Coder
16.03.2019, 16:21
@ psg
|
Atrybuty specjalne |
> Witam,
> w ośrodku potrzebują żeby w atrybutach danego obiektu, gdzie nie znamy
> wartości, w miejscu gdzie mogą być stosowane atrybuty specjalne to żeby je
> wstawiać.
> Mowa tu o atrybutach z załącznika nr 2 z rozporządzenia o mapie zasadniczej
> z 2015r. np.: "inapplicable", "missing" itp.
> Nie wiem też jak sam powinienem to wpisywać, żeby właściwie im się
> pokazywało, czy "missing" czy może"<missing>" ?
> Jeśli będzie możliwość to może udało by się Panu to wstawić w odpowiednie
> miejsca. Chyba, że już jest to możliwe a nie zauważyłem.
> Pozdrawiam.
Obecnie wszystkie puste pola otrzymują nilReason=template
Mogę wprowadzić globalne definiowanie przyczyny, ale wpiywanie w każdym pustym polu przyczyny braku wydaje mi się bez sensu. --- Admin
|
psg
20.03.2019, 18:24
@ Coder
|
Atrybuty specjalne |
Wydaje mi się, że mam najnowszą wersję MM, ale ta wartość "template" raczej mi się nie ustawia tam gdzie trzeba, a gdzie nie wpisuje danych.
Sprawdzam teraz swoje pliki GML w innych programach i nie widnieje tam nigdzie w żadnym polu "template" lub coś pochodnego.
W ośrodku inspektorka też pokazywała mi że w pustych polach nie ma dopuszczalnych prawidłowych wartości.
Dla mnie ten GML to jest coś dziwnego co ktoś stworzył bez potrzeby a teraz trzeba się do tego dostosować na siłe, tak czy inaczej pliki mi nie przechodzą w ośrodku. |
Coder
20.03.2019, 18:35
@ psg
|
Atrybuty specjalne |
> Wydaje mi się, że mam najnowszą wersję MM, ale ta wartość "template" raczej
> mi się nie ustawia tam gdzie trzeba, a gdzie nie wpisuje danych.
> Sprawdzam teraz swoje pliki GML w innych programach i nie widnieje tam
> nigdzie w żadnym polu "template" lub coś pochodnego.
> W ośrodku inspektorka też pokazywała mi że w pustych polach nie ma
> dopuszczalnych prawidłowych wartości.
> Dla mnie ten GML to jest coś dziwnego co ktoś stworzył bez potrzeby a teraz
> trzeba się do tego dostosować na siłe, tak czy inaczej pliki mi nie
> przechodzą w ośrodku.
Kiedyś było bodajże nilReason=unknown, ale ktoś poprosił o zmiane na template, bo jego ośrodek własnie tak wymagał.
Docelowo chciałbym ustawić jakąś domyślna wartość sprawdzająca się w 90% przypadków, a dla reszty
Dla wybranych parametrów ustawić inną, typowa dla nich wartość
a dopiero w ostateczności wpisywać ręcznie - mam nadzieję że to nie będzie konieczne.
O jakich atrybutach była mowa w Pana przypadku? --- Admin
|
psg
20.03.2019, 18:43
@ Coder
|
Atrybuty specjalne |
Dziękuje za odpowiedź.
Mam "niepoprawne wartości numeryczne w atrybutach obiektów GESUT np. średnica (należy stosować wartości specjalne)".
Może żeby nie mieszać to zapytam tak: czy dla pól których wartości nie znam, np. średnica przewodu, jeśli zostawię puste pole, to sama ustawi się wartość "template" i turboewid będzie zadowolony ?? |
Pioter
21.03.2019, 07:47
@ psg
|
Atrybuty specjalne |
> Dziękuje za odpowiedź.
> Mam "niepoprawne wartości numeryczne w atrybutach obiektów GESUT np.
> średnica (należy stosować wartości specjalne)".
>
> Może żeby nie mieszać to zapytam tak: czy dla pól których wartości nie
> znam, np. średnica przewodu, jeśli zostawię puste pole, to sama ustawi się
> wartość "template" i turboewid będzie zadowolony ??
Ogólnie jeżeli chodzi o wartości voidable to powinny być one wybieralne dla poszczególnych atrybutów. Stosuje się je w obiektach Gesut jak i Egib. Jeżeli nie znasz średnicy powinieneś ustawić wartość unknow ( nieznany ). Ale jakie wartości voidable jakim atrybutom danym obiektom się stosuje, powinien Ci udostępnić Podgik.
Ja akurat nie robię plików gml w MM , bo nasz powiat udostępnia GeoInfo Delta, ale moim zdaniem te wartości powinny być wybieralne z listy możliwości. Są one zdefiniowane o ile się nie myle w rozporządzeniach ( na pewno w rozp. w sprawie bazy Gesut). Jeżeli będziecie je wpisywać z "palca" to program w ośrodku może ich nie rozpoznać i będzie je traktować jako nowe wartości słownikowe. Ogólnie zawsze powinno być dostępne pięć wartości voidable:
inapplicable - nie stosuje się
missing - brak danych
template - tymczasowy brak danych
unknow - nieznany
witheld - zastrzeżony
Jeżeli ośrodek nie udostępnia jak wypełniać dane atrybuty to co każdy znaczy jest opisane w rozporządzeniu w sprawie bazy Gesut ( załącznik nr 2 paragraf 8) |
psg
23.03.2019, 11:37
@ Pioter
|
Atrybuty specjalne |
Dzięki za odpowiedź.
Ośrodek jest na etapie przyzwyczajania się do Turboewidu i często są uwagi, a jakby ktoś chciał dowiedzieć się jak to rozwiązać, to bywa że do końca nie wiedzą, długi temat
Co do tych atrybutów to fajnie jakby w średnicy przewodów, średnicy studzienek, osadników - gdy zostawiam puste pole, to żeby wstawiał się atrybut np. template i myśle, że to już będzie przechodzić.
Mam jeszcze takie uwagi z ośrodka do sprawdzenia przy okazji tworzenia gmla:
- rów przydrożny nie pokazuje się właściwa linia po zaczytaniu w ośrodku,
- słup kratowy pokazuje się jako 4 kółeczka ze znakami zapytania...
Może ktoś wie jak prawidłowo zrobić słup kratowy i eksportować do gml, od etapu pikiety.
Z góry dziękuje. |
Coder
23.03.2019, 12:15
@ psg
|
Atrybuty specjalne |
> Mam jeszcze takie uwagi z ośrodka do sprawdzenia przy okazji tworzenia
> gmla:
> - rów przydrożny nie pokazuje się właściwa linia po zaczytaniu w ośrodku,
> - słup kratowy pokazuje się jako 4 kółeczka ze znakami zapytania...
> Może ktoś wie jak prawidłowo zrobić słup kratowy i eksportować do gml, od
> etapu pikiety.
Prosze mi przesłac mapkę z takmi elementami --- Admin
|
psg
25.03.2019, 21:32
@ Coder
|
Atrybuty specjalne |
Witam, wysłałem mail. |